Sixth graders on the Enterprise Team at EMS spent a day giving back through community service with various organizations across Chittenden County. The students were divided into five groups: one helped remove invasive species with the Winooski Valley Park District; another weeded and cleaned up an 18th-century garden at the Ethan Allen Homestead Museum. A third group visited Maple Ridge Assisted Living to play games with residents, while another restocked shelves at Aunt Dot’s Place. The final group baked dog treats to raise funds for Therapy Dogs of Vermont.
Our team is working hard to ensure kids across our community have access to healthy, delicious meals while school is out. This year, we are proud to sponsor two summer meal sites locally, where children 18 and under can enjoy free meals in a welcoming environment. These meals must be consumed on-site (no grab-and-go). No registration is required - just show up.
- Maple Street Park Pool Concessions (Essex Jct.): Breakfast from 9-11 a.m. (Monday-Friday), Lunch from 11 a.m. until 6 p.m. (Monday-Friday), Lunch only from 11 a.m. until 6 p.m. (Weekends)
- Fort Ethan Allen - near the gazebo (Colchester): Lunch from 11:30 a.m. until 12:30 p.m. (Monday-Friday)
Families needing food assistance are welcome to visit the pantry! The Heavenly Food Pantry, located at the First Congregational Church on Main Street in Essex Junction, will be open to families residing in Essex, Essex Junction, and Westford on Thursday, June 26, from 3-6 p.m.
As usual, there are no income requirements to visit the food pantry, and a variety of food is available to everyone; however, additional food is provided by the USDA to eligible families who fall below federally mandated guidelines. Families not able to attend the pantry may call the Church office at (802)878-5745 Ext. 4 between 9 a.m. and noon today through Thursday to leave contact information so arrangements
for delivery can be made. Calls will be made to complete registration on Thursday morning, so please be sure to leave a number so that we can reach you at that time.
Visits to the pantry can be made once each calendar month- either on the second Monday of each month from 5:30-7:30 p.m. or the fourth Thursday of each month from 3-6 p.m. The next food pantry distribution will be on Monday, July 7, from 5:30-7:30 p.m.

Congratulations to Essex Middle School teacher Andrew Kasprisin on his designation as the 2025 Vermont finalist for the Presidential Awards for Excellence in Mathematics and Science Teaching. This award is the highest honor bestowed by the United States government specifically for K-12 science, technology, engineering, and mathematics teaching.
Essex Junction Recreation & Parks, Essex Pediatrics, and Essex CHiPS proudly present The Screenagers Project: Growing Up in the Digital Age Community Film Screenings at Essex Cinemas on June 4 & 11! This film screening is a great opportunity to come together with families, friends, and neighbors to learn more about the impact of kids' use of screens, smartphones, and social media on their mental health. Following the 60-minute film, participants are invited to stay for a 30-minute discussion time to talk about collective community action solutions and steps to move this important conversation forward.
